Abstract

During the construction and operation of buildings and structures of increased responsibility in areas with weak soils, it is necessary to use bored piles of great length and diameter. They carry considerable loads—most of which are transferred to the surrounding ground along the lateral surface, and the rest of which is transferred to the underlying relatively dense layer. Consequently, the reserves of the bearing capacity of the underlying soils are not fully utilized. The piling depth of high-rise buildings usually ranges from 20 to 120 m, depending on the depth of the bedrock piles over 30 m are beyond the scope of mass design and require a special approach at all stages of the calculation and design, starting with engineering and geological surveys. This article describes the construction of Europe’s tallest building, the 462 m tall Lakhta center skyscraper.
